Dr. Madesis Panagiotis was born in Thessaloniki on 19/01/1971, he is married and the father of two children. He studied at the School of Geotechnical Sciences of the Aristotle University of Thessaloniki. Later he completed his postgraduate studies in the Laboratory of Plant Genetics and Improvement of the School of Geotechnical Sciences of the Aristotle University of Thessaloniki. He also completed his doctoral dissertation in the same department. At the same time, the last year of his doctoral dissertation was held at the University of Manchester in the laboratory of plant science with an emphasis on the treatment of genetic material in chloroplasts. During this period he worked on a number of research projects. Madesis Panagiotis has completed his studies with the help of the following scholarships Marie Curie Scholarship at the University of Manchester, IKY State Scholarship Foundation. In 2004 he received a postdoctoral fellowship in the study of chloroplast DNA and worked at the School of Health Sciences, University of Manchester, in the plant science laboratory. Since October 2008 he holds the position of DG Level Researcher and from 01/10/2011 the DG Level Researcher at the Institute of Applied Life Sciences (INEB) His research interests are focused on the improvement of plants with conventional and biotechnological methods to increase production. , resistance to biotic and abiotic stresses, the production of valuable products, the genotyping of species and varieties, the assessment of biodiversity
through the identification and identification of species.
He teaches the course “Recombinant protein production systems” at the postgraduate department of the Agricultural University of Athens, gives lectures at the Department of Agriculture specializing in food technology on genetic and genomic technologies and has taught the Plant Improvement laboratory.
He is a member of the editorial team in the Journal of Plant Studies, and a reviewer in scientific journals and has published more than 90 scientific studies, 4 chapters in books with a total of more than 800 heteroreferences. He has also been invited as a keynote speaker at a large number of national and international workshops and conferences. Advisor of the committee JM 135086 / 31-1-2011, Office of Biotechnology Products, Directorate of Crop Production Inputs, Ministry of Rural Development and Food, for genetically modified plants.
He is also a member of the Marie Curie Fellows Association (MCFA), the Hellenic Society of Biological Sciences (EEBE) and the Geotechnical Chamber of Greece (GEOT.EE), the Hellenic Scientific Society for Plant Genetic Improvement (EEEGBF) of which since 2012 he is and a member of the Board of Directors, is finally the treasurer of the CERTH research association.
Dr. Madesis Panagiotis participates in the execution of funded projects, collaborates with private companies in conducting research for the improvement of plants, while he has also developed the methodology for the identification of plant species such as important products of designation of origin (PDO) fava Santorini, Beans, Feta cheese, olive oil, etc., and their traceability and the detection of possible counterfeiting in commercial products,
For his remarkable reasearch he was awarded in September 2013 by the Ministry of Rural Development and in October 2013 by the President of the Republic.
